Habakkuk Baldonado


Pittsburgh Panthers (ACC)
Clearwater Academy International
Clearwater, FL via Rome, Italy
View Profile

From Pittsburgh's Media Guide:
Gained significant FBS recruiting interest despite playing just one season of high school football in the United States…played three years of American football in his native Italy (Rome) before moving to Florida in 2017…played defensive end and receiver at Clearwater Academy International under Coach Jesse Chinchar…totaled 83 tackles, a whopping 30.5 sacks, nine forced fumbles and three fumble recoveries on defense…as a receiver, averaged 24.4 yards per reception (nine catches for 220 yards) and scored two touchdowns.

Unofficial 40yd Dash
1st Attempt: 4.78u

Jose Ramirez


Eastern Michigan
Auburndale High School
Hometown: Lake Alfred, FL
View Profile

From Eastern Michigan media guide:
Attended Auburndale High School and played under Head Coach Billy Deeds as a Bloodhound...Ranked as a three-star recruit by 247Sports...Earned four letters in football at wide receiver, cornerback, safety and linebacker...Recorded 148 tackles, 7.5 TFL, 1.5 sacks, 1 PBU 2 forced fumbles, and a fumble recovery in three seasons at Auburndale...Served as a team captain his senior year...Earned all-state honors as a senior...Led his team with 114 tackles as a senior...Also had one blocked kick and one forced fumble...Finished his career with 99 solo tackles...Racked up 114 tackles, 6.5 TFL, 0.5 sack, a PBU, a forced fumble, a fumble recovery for a touchdown, and a blocked punt during his senior campaign


Unofficial 40yd
1st: 5.00u
2nd: 4.93u
